You just have to trust me on this one. Back in the early 80's FtW mugs were sold as lifetime, not length of stay. I can't address mugs from the other resorts. The "lifetime" clause ended in or around 1985. In the early 90's we started buying mugs from every resort just about every year until 2007, when they went to a generic mug for all resorts. The blue, generic mug that came out in 2007 had the year "2007" branded on it. In 2008 they sold the same generic, blue mug, only without a year on it. In 2009, they came out with the current design.
